This paper addresses pedagogical practices developed in the context of the Communication Design Degree at Lusofona University of Porto, Portugal, aimed at integrating students into the workforce as well as raising awareness for the importance of the designer's role as a social agent through projects carried out for social institutions, including the Portuguese Red Cross and Eu Sou Eu - Association for the Social Inclusion of Children and Young People. The projects include the development of campaigns to raise volunteers and funds for the institutions, development of visual identities and printed publications. These practices require direct contact with the client and knowledge of the institution's mission, forms of social action and specificities, for the construction of solutions adjusted and oriented towards their needs and the needs of the community they serve. These pedagogical approaches have proven to be an added value for the students' training resulting in an effective opportunity for them to work with clients in real projects; the possibility to see their work recognized, published, and used by the community; and a growing awareness for the importance of the designer's role as a social agent.
